The Magnificent Bang Pa-In Palace
The Bang Pa-In Palace, nestled along the banks of the Chao Phraya River, is a stunning architectural marvel that showcases the harmonious fusion of European and Thai design elements.
Built as a summer retreat for the Thai royal family, the palace boasts a diverse array of structures, from ornate pavilions to serene gardens.
Visitors can explore the iconic Aisawan Thiphya-Art pavilion, with its distinctive Thai roof and European-inspired decor.
The palace’s captivating blend of styles reflects the Thai monarchy’s openness to international influences, making it a truly remarkable historical site to behold.

What Is the Best Time of Year to Visit Ayutthaya?
The best time to visit Ayutthaya is during the cool and dry season from November to February when the weather is comfortable for exploring the historical sites. It’s also less crowded compared to the hot and humid summer months.

Is There a Dress Code for Visiting the Royal Palaces?
There’s a strict dress code for visiting royal palaces – no shorts, short skirts, sleeveless shirts, tight or see-through clothing allowed. Modest attire covering shoulders and knees is required to enter these historical sites.
